Description of key information

Stability

Hydrolysis

The study does not need to be conducted because the substance is readily biodegradable.

Biodegradation

Biodegradation in water: screening tests

Based on a read across to the source substances Methanol and Methyl acetate the registration substance is considered to be readily biodegradable.

Biodegradation in water and sediment: simulation tests

The study does not need to be conducted because the registration substance is readily biodegradable.

Biodegradation in soil

The study does not need to be conducted because the registration substance is readily biodegradable.

Bioaccumulation

Bioaccumulation: aquatic/sediment

The study does not need to be conducted because the registration substance has a low potential for bioaccumulation based on log Pow <= 3 (study scientifically not necessary). However, based on a read across to the source substance Methanol a BCF <10 was derived.

Transport and distribution

Adsorption/desorption

The study does not need to be conducted because the registration substance has a low octanol water partitioning coefficient and the adsorption potential of this substance is related to this parameter (study scientifically not necessary). However, based on a read across approach to Methanol the Koc of the registration substance was determined to be  0.13 - 1.
